Job Outlook & Work Environment
Job Outlook
🚀 287,800; estimated number of electrical engineer jobs. It is estimated that 26,200 new jobs will be added by 2033.
☀️ The projected job outlook for electrical engineers is 9%, which is much faster than average.
Work Environment
💼 Most electrical engineers work in offices, but some visit sites to observe equipment.
🏢 19% of electrical engineers work in Telecommunications.
Electrical Engineer Salary in Comparison to Patent Law Salaries
How Does an Electrical Engineer Salary Stack Up?
The average electrical engineer earns $106,950 per year on average. This is around $25,000 short of the typical patent agent salary, which is $130,168 annually.
Therefore, from a salary standpoint, electrical engineers who take the patent bar exam and transition into a career in patent law will earn more than their counterparts. Patent attorneys earn an average of $185,351 annually, which is nearly $80K more than the average electrical engineer’s salary.
Top Electrical Engineer Salaries by Industry
Industry | Average Salary |
---|---|
Manufacturing Magnetic and Optical Media | $217,470 |
Software Publishers | $177,350 |
Computer Equipment Manufacturing | $174,590 |
Oil and Gas Extraction | $155,660 |
Other Pipeline Transportation | $151,550 |
Salary by Electrical Engineer Industry
In the U.S., the average electrical engineering salary is $106,950.
Electrical engineers in the Manufacturing Magnetic and Optical Media industry earn the highest average salary at $217,470. Those in the Software Publishers and Computer Equipment Manufacturing industries receive average salaries of $177,350 and $174,590, respectively. The Oil and Gas Extraction and Other Pipeline Transportation industries offer lower average salaries, at $155,660 and $151,550.

Top Electrical Engineer Salaries by Location
Factors that Impact Pay
Electrical engineers in San Jose, CA, earned the highest average salary among the cities listed, at $185,390. Santa Barbara, CA, and San Francisco, CA, follow with average salaries of $154,220 and $150,500, respectively. Albuquerque, NM, and Chico, CA, offer lower average salaries, at $139,340 and $136,220.
Electrical engineers in California earn the highest average salary among the states listed, at $147,340. New Mexico and New Hampshire follow with average salaries of $135,310 and $132,810, respectively. The District of Columbia and Massachusetts offer slightly lower average salaries, at $127,950 and $127,930.
Take a look at the average electrical engineer salaries from top-paying cities according to Bls.gov data.
City | Average Salary |
---|---|
San Jose, CA | $185,390 |
Santa Barbara, CA | $154,220 |
San Francisco, CA | $150,500 |
Albuquerque, NM | $139,340 |
Chico, CA | $136,220 |
Look at the average electrical engineer salaries from top-paying states according to Bls.gov data.
State | Average Salary |
---|---|
California | $147,340 |
New Mexico | $135,310 |
New Hampshire | $132,810 |
District of Columbia | $127,950 |
Massachusetts | $127,930 |
